        10 killed in landslide in NE India
        Source: Xinhua   2018-06-05 13:15:31

        NEW DELHI, June 5 (Xinhua) -- At least 10 people have been killed in a landslide in the northeastern Indian state of Mizoram, police said Tuesday.

        The landslide happened in Lunglei town and was triggered by heavy rains that started lashing large parts of southern Mizoram since late Monday night.

        "The victims lost their lives after their house was swept away by the landslide. One person who sustained injuries in the natural disaster has been hospitalised," a police official said.

        The district disaster response team has rushed to the spot. "Rescue workers are searching for bodies and other people feared trapped in the debris since this morning," he said.

        Landslides are common in northern and northeastern India in the monsoon season from July to September as well as in the pre-monsoon month of June.

        In June last year, some 10 people were killed and several went missing after flash floods and landslides caused by heavy rains wreaked havoc in Lunglei district.
